Memory care facilities in Uniontown, Pennsylvania are designed for families seeking living arrangements that offer assistance to their loved ones dealing with memory-related challenges. Moving to a memory care facility is a significant decision, often undertaken when a loved one requires more comprehensive care due to conditions like Alzheimer's or dementia. Uniontown, located in the southwestern part of the state, offers a range of memory care options for families seeking dedicated support for their loved ones.
For those considering the transition to a memory care facility in Uniontown, it's essential to understand the available financial assistance programs in Pennsylvania. Navigating the costs associated with memory care can be overwhelming, but the state provides support through various programs. Families can explore options such as Medicaid, which may cover some of the expenses related to memory care facilities. Also, the Pennsylvania Department of Aging offers programs like the Aging Waiver, aimed at providing in-home and community-based services to eligible seniors, potentially alleviating the financial burden associated with memory care.
The proximity of Uniontown to larger cities in the region enhances the accessibility of memory care options. Families in search of memory care facilities can explore nearby cities like Pittsburgh, Morgantown, and Greensburg. These urban centers offer additional choices, providing families with the flexibility to find a memory care facility that best suits the needs of their loved ones.
In summary, the decision to move a loved one to a memory care facility in Uniontown, Pennsylvania involves careful consideration of both the available facilities and the financial aspects. Pennsylvania offers support through programs like Medicaid and the Aging Waiver, which can help alleviate some of the financial burdens associated with memory care. With the convenience of larger cities like Pittsburgh, Morgantown, and Greensburg in close proximity, families have a range of memory care options to explore, ensuring that their loved ones receive the specialized care and support they need in a secure and nurturing environment.

Frequently Asked Questions About Memory Care Facilities in Uniontown, Pennsylvania
What services are typically offered at memory care facilities in Uniontown, Pennsylvania?
Memory care facilities in Uniontown, Pennsylvania, typically offer a wide range of specialized services tailored to individuals with Alzheimer's disease, dementia, and other cognitive impairments. These services may include 24/7 supervision and care by trained professionals, personalized care plans, and assistance with activities of daily living (ADLs) such as bathing, dressing, and grooming. Additionally, memory care facilities may often provide secure environments to prevent wandering, cognitive therapies to slow the progression of memory loss, medication management, and structured activities designed to promote cognitive function and social engagement. Facilities may also offer amenities such as nutritious meals, housekeeping, laundry services, transportation, and access to on-site medical care or physical therapy.
How do memory care facilities ensure the safety of their residents?
Memory care facilities often implement several safety measures to protect their residents. These may include secured entryways and exits to prevent residents from wandering off, which is a common concern in individuals with dementia. Many facilities are designed with a layout that minimizes confusion and reduces the risk of falls, such as circular hallways and open common areas. Additionally, residents are often equipped with wearable devices that allow staff to monitor their location and wellbeing. Emergency response systems should be in place, with staff trained to handle crises such as medical emergencies or behavioral issues promptly. Regular safety drills and staff training sessions should further ensure that all team members are prepared to provide a secure environment for residents.
What should families consider when choosing a memory care facility in Uniontown, Pennsylvania?
When choosing a memory care facility in Uniontown, Pennsylvania, families should consider several important factors to ensure they select the best environment for their loved one. First, it's crucial to evaluate the facility's staff-to-resident ratio, as this can impact the level of personalized care and attention each resident receives. The qualifications and training of the staff, particularly in dementia care, should also be assessed. Families should visit the facility to observe the cleanliness, atmosphere, and overall environment, paying close attention to how residents interact with staff and each other. It's also essential to review the range of services and activities offered, ensuring they align with the specific needs and interests of the individual. Additionally, consider the facility's policies on medical care, including how they manage health issues and emergencies. Finally, cost is an important factor, so families should understand the pricing structure and what services are included or available at an additional cost. Reading reviews and asking for references can also provide valuable insights into the facility's reputation and quality of care.
How do memory care facilities in UNIONTOWN support the emotional and social well-being of their residents?
Memory care facilities in UNIONTOWN often place a strong emphasis on supporting the emotional and social well-being of their residents, recognizing that these aspects are crucial to overall quality of life. Facilities may offer a variety of activities designed to foster social interaction, such as group outings, art and music therapy, gardening, and communal dining experiences. These activities help residents maintain a sense of community and connection, which can be especially important for those with dementia who may feel isolated or confused. In addition to social activities, many memory care facilities provide counseling services, both individual and group, to address emotional needs and help residents cope with the challenges of memory loss. Family involvement is also encouraged, with some facilities hosting regular family events and support groups to help loved ones stay connected and engaged in their family member's care. The staff should be often trained to provide compassionate, person-centered care, ensuring that each resident feels valued, understood, and supported in their daily life.
Are there any specialized memory care programs available in Uniontown, Pennsylvania, that focus on specific stages of dementia?
Some memory care facilities in Uniontown, Pennsylvania may offer specialized programs tailored to specific stages of dementia. These programs are designed to meet the unique needs of individuals at different levels of cognitive decline, providing appropriate care and activities that cater to their current abilities. Early-stage programs often focus on maintaining cognitive function and independence through activities that stimulate the brain, such as memory exercises, puzzles, and social engagement. As dementia progresses, mid-stage programs may emphasize structured routines, physical activities, and emotional support to help residents navigate daily challenges. For those in the later stages of dementia, memory care facilities may offer more intensive care with a focus on comfort, safety, and quality of life, including sensory stimulation therapies and personalized care plans. Families should inquire about the specific programs offered at each facility and how they adapt to the changing needs of residents as their condition evolves.
